Text
To facilitate the making of investigations by the secretary, in the interest of the public safety and the promotion of aeronautics, the reports of investigations or hearings, or any part thereof, or any testimony given thereat, shall not be admitted in evidence or used for any purpose in any suit, action, or proceeding growing out of any matter referred to in said investigation, hearing, or report thereof, except in case of criminal or other proceedings instituted by or on behalf of the Department of Public Safety and Corrections under the provisions of this Chapter.
